> The fact that a command displays something does not make it a display
> command.  Display commands are those that only display something, and
> don't modify tree/branch/repo state.
> 
> There are some errors, like pipe errors, which are not a concern for
> commands like log which only display information.  For commands like
> uncommit, or commit, or anything that modifies state, these are a
> concern, because we don't know whether we were interrupted before,
> after, or in the middle of performing operations.  When write command is
> interrupted by a pipe error etc., we need to signal the user that
> something weird has happened.  The purpose of the display_command
> decorator is to prevent us from signalling the user.  So it is
> fundamentally a bad idea for commands that do anything other than
> display data.
